Capcom announces SSFIV AE Ver 2012 update

Capcom has announced Super Street Fighter IV: Arcade Edition will get a Version 2012 update. No more details were given other than more will be coming soon, and that it will be playable in major Japanese cities by the end of the summer. To be clear, it isn't a new edition of SFIV, just an update. We're pretty sure we heard producer Yoshinori Ono say at EVO overnight there'd be an update due sometime between autumn and winter that will help balance the game. This is probably it.
